verb : SUFFOCATE
Source:WordNet 3.1
-
1. (
) deprive of oxygen and prevent from breathing; "Othello smothered Desdemona with a pillow"; "The child suffocated herself with a plastic bag that the parents had left on the floor" ;
-
2. (
) impair the respiration of or obstruct the air passage of; "The foul air was slowly suffocating the children" ;
-
3. (
) become stultified, suppressed, or stifled; "He is suffocating;
-
4. (
) suppress the development, creativity, or imagination of; "His job suffocated him" ;
-
5. (
) be asphyxiated; die from lack of oxygen; "The child suffocated under the pillow" ;
-
6. (
) feel uncomfortable for lack of fresh air; "The room was hot and stuffy and we were suffocating" ;
-
7. (
) struggle for breath; have insufficient oxygen intake; "he swallowed a fishbone and gagged" ;
